第二篇:走近Windows Azure数据中心

原创
云计算
想了解Windows Azure和Azure服务平台,有必要了解微软数据中心是如何工作的。本文概述了微软如何设计其数据中心、为何第四代数据中心是如此革命性的数据中心。

想了解Windows Azure和Azure服务平台,有必要了解微软数据中心是如何工作的。本文概述了微软如何设计其数据中心、为何第四代数据中心是如此革命性的数据中心。

数据中心的构建

长期以来,微软一直在构建数据中心。微软提供的最知名服务之一是Windows Update,作为其遍布全球的内容分发网络的一项功能,Windows Update会分发更新版。但这不是微软数据中心赖以成名的唯一产品。其他重要产品包括Windows Live Messenger、Hotmail和Windows Live ID。Windows Live Messenger是市面上最主要的即时通讯(IM)软件之一,Hotmail是一种常用的电子邮件软件。微软每天授权数百万用户使用其Live Services,该服务用于Hotmail、Messenger和其他众多服务。众所周知,微软在构建数据中心方面有着丰富经验,但迄今为止还没有销售Windows Azure之类的产品。

微软的第四代数据中心

微软研究部在改进数据中心方面做得很出色,尤其是在构建数据中心方面。微软称之为Generation 4 Datacenters(第四代数据中心)。它们采用工业化设计——组件一律标准化,这就降低了成本,让厂商们在为微软设计服务器时能够使用模板。第四代数据中心基本上是内置容器——是的,这些内容本质上与我们所说的船用集装箱没什么两样。这种设计有着重大优势。设象一下:数据中心需要搬迁。微软只需要几辆卡车和一些工具,几乎就可以完成搬迁工作。这种设计的主要优点是,惠普和戴尔等服务器厂商完全知道服务器机架应该怎么样,只要把机架添加到容器当中。如果数据中心需要扩展,第四代数据中心只要为现有容器另外添加一些容器就行。此外,微软致力于为冷却系统开发标准工具,那样本地维护工作人员就很容易接受系统方面的培训。值得一提的是,第四代数据中心并不仅仅是集装箱式的服务器机房。微软对于第四代数据中心所做的是,改善了构建和运行数据中心的整个生命周期。这给微软带来了一些额外好处,比如更快速地进入市场、降低成本。

微软数据中心如何有助于环保?

“绿色IT”这个术语的出现已经有些年头了。微软很重视绿色IT,尽量设法减小其数据中心的能耗量。对于微软来说,这不仅仅有可能降低能源和冷却成本,还有可能保护我们的环境。对于第四代数据中心,微软设法用环保材料来构建容器,并且充分利用“自然冷却”(ambient cooling)。最近构建的一个数据中心致力于充分利用数据中心所在的自然环境,减少冷却服务器系统所需要的能源数量。有几个最佳实践和几篇文章介绍微软如何构建环保的数据中心。文章末尾处附有几个链接。

想了解微软数据中心设计的概况,该视频(http://www.microsoft.com/showcase/en/us/details/36db4da6-8777-431e-aefb-316ccbb63e4e)解释了第四代数据中心是如何构建的。

微软数据中心的安全性

微软在构建数据中心和操作系统方面有着悠久传统。几十年来,微软不得不面对企图攻击微软操作系统的黑客、病毒及其他恶意软件。微软从这些攻击中汲取了比其他厂商更多的经验,冻僵开始构建一种全面的安全方法。我在本文中提到的文档描述了微软为安全云计算环境而采用的策略。微软成立了一支在线服务安全和合规团队,致力于将安全技术实施到应用程序和平台中。微软为安全可靠的云计算环境给予的主要保障是,承诺可信计算,而且加强隐私。微软采取了“默认情况下确保隐私”的做法。

为了保护数据中心的安全,微软持有多家安全组织的数据中心认证,比如国际标准化组织及国际电工委员会(ISO/IEC)和英国标准协会(British Standards Institute)。此外,微软使用了ISO/IEC27001:2005安全框架。这包括了“规划、实施、检查和行动”四个要点。

如果你想更深入地了解这个话题,建议你不妨阅读《确保微软云基础架构的安全》白皮书(http://www.microsoft.com/downloads/en/details.aspx?FamilyID=3de2d4d1-e668-4d82-852b-5fa2645aa8df)。

虚拟机方面的情况

 

图5解释了Windows Azure数据中心里面的具体情况。我在Windows Azure开发团队高级项目经理David Lempher的博客上找到了该信息,他概述了数据中心里面的情况。首先,服务器启动,下载维护操作系统。该操作系统现在可以与名为“Fabric Controller”(Azure结构控制器)的服务进行对话。该服务负责整体的平台管理,服务器接到指令后,用主机虚拟机建立一个主机分区。一旦这步完成,服务器会重新启动,装入主机虚拟机。主机虚拟机经配置后,可在数据中心里面运行,并与其他虚拟机安全地进行通信。我们所用的服务不在主机虚拟机中运行。名为来宾虚拟机(Guest VM)的另一个虚拟机在主机虚拟机里面运行(主机虚拟机本地启动)。由于我们现在有了虚拟机角色,每个来宾虚拟机都有比较存储区(diff-store),会存储对虚拟机所作的变化内容。标准映像从来不会被改动。每个主机虚拟机可以含有好几个来宾虚拟机。

参考链接:

第四代数据中心

第四代数据中心:架构师的视角

微软构建环保型数据中心的十大最佳实践

微软的可持续数据中心获得绿色企业IT大奖

Windows Azure数据中心里面到底是啥样?
 

原文名:Understanding Windows Azure——Part 2: A look inside the Windows Azure datacenters 作者:Mario Meir-Huber

【本文乃51CTO精选译文,转载请标明出处!】

【编辑推荐】

 

 

  1. 微软公布云计算平台Azure收费模式细节
  2. 云计算意在长远,微软云计算服务Windows Azure已经启用
  3. 技术透析:Windows Azure Platform框架与组成
  4. 微软Windows Azure Platform技术解析
  5. 走近微软云:SQL Server到Azure数据同步
  6. 当微软Azure遭遇亚马逊EC2:五大关键区别
  7. Windows Azure云计算平台新增五大功能
  8. 云计算前途光明 Azure用户数突破31000
  9. 如何把应用程序部署到Windows Azure中

 

责任编辑:王勇 来源: 来源:51CTO
相关推荐

2014-12-02 09:29:51

Facebook数据中心运维

2014-03-28 13:30:36

2012-04-10 15:13:42

微软Windows Azu数据中心

2011-06-21 10:28:49

Oracle

2022-08-02 10:26:09

网络层网络网络协议

2017-04-10 14:46:29

AndroidGradleBuild.gradl

2021-05-17 15:03:13

数据中心云计算绿色数据中心

2012-12-24 13:27:55

微软Style公有云Windows Azu

2021-07-10 07:39:38

Node.js C++V8

2012-06-26 10:39:42

数据中心

2014-09-11 13:55:58

Equinix数据中心

2011-05-26 18:07:30

Azure数据中心

2015-06-17 11:33:58

数据中心模块化

2010-09-16 09:44:56

2011-04-21 16:08:45

Facebook数据中心方案展示

2011-05-05 15:35:06

Facebook数据中心方案展示

2010-08-20 15:02:35

数据中心布线

2010-10-14 13:54:07

AT&T

2009-12-28 00:31:57

2009数据中心之变布线

2011-04-25 10:19:31

点赞
收藏

51CTO技术栈公众号